From: Zorro Lang Date: Thu, 18 Feb 2016 23:49:54 +0000 (+1100) Subject: xfs: new test default user/group quota X-Git-Tag: v2022.05.01~2601 X-Git-Url: https://www.infradead.org/git/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=08aac973d5991d8bcbc64125bdd71e9af00424f1;p=users%2Fhch%2Fxfstests-dev.git xfs: new test default user/group quota When default quota is set, all different quota types inherits the same default value, include group quota. So if a user quota limit larger than the default user quota value, it will still be limited by the group default quota value.
